The OHS Services Academy final march out for students in years 10-13 was organised and entirely run by Year 13 academy students who have demonstrated great leadership and dedication to the academy this year.
The students’ personal discipline and drill skills were on display and impressive. Wilson Mata’s address highlighted the commitment, comradeship, courage and integrity of the senior members of the academy.
Year 11, 12 and 13 award winners were announced, with the most prestigious Year 13 awards announced at the Northern Region Services Academy march out parade.
The Northern Region Services march out parade was held at St Pauls’ school in Grey Lynn. Thirteen OHS senior academy members attended and our most prestigious awards presented.
